Indigo Plateau



Preparing for the ultimate battles

 

Just like in Red, Blue, and Yellow, you will fight the Elite Four and Pokémon League Champion one after another with chances to heal your Pokémon in between. So I suggest before you go up the stairs to the first battle, buy plenty of healing items and Revives, because you might need them, and they definitely come in handy.




Will

 

Will is your first match. He is a Psychic Trainer and uses a new Pokémon called Xatu. It is a Psychic Bird that evolved from Natu. Electric attacks should do the trick on everything except for Exeggutor. A fire Pokémon can take out Exeggutor easily.

Koga

 

It looks like Koga has moved from being a Gym Leader to an Elite Four member. He still uses Poison type Pokémon. If you have a Kadabra or a Pokémon with Psychic, it can easily wipe out all of Koga's Pokémon.

Bruno

 

Bruno is back and he's using his favorite Pokémon types: Fighting and Rock. Hitmontop is a Hitmonlee/chan relative. It's the one where it spins on its head with three feet in the air. You should have a strong water Pokémon that can take out all of Bruno's Pokémon. If not, a psychic like Kadabra can do.

Karen

 

Karen likes to use a variety of Pokémon, but mostly Dark ones. Umbreon is the Eevee evolution that you can get if you level up Eevee at night (Espeon, the Psychic one, by leveling up Eevee during the day.) Use a powerful attack to knock out Umbreon. Vileplume can be taken out with a fire move. Murkrow is a crow Pokémon. One electric attack should knock it out quickly. Gengar doesn't like Psychic. Houndoom is a devilish looking fire dog. Use Hydro Pump or Surf.

Lance

 

Looks like Lance beat you to being the Pokémon League Master. Like in Red, Blue, and Yellow, Lance likes to use his Dragon type Pokémon. Lance uses basically the same lineup as in Red, Blue, and Yellow, except for the fact that he has 2 Dragonites in place of his 2 Dragonairs. But that makes it even easier. Gyarados - Electric attack. Dragonite - part flying - Ice or electric attack. Dragonite - Ice or electric attack. Aerodactyl - Hydro Pump or Surf. Charizard - Hydro Pump or Surf. Dragonite - Ice attack.

The End

 

Congratulations you have become a Pokémon League Champion. Professor Elm and an interviewer named Mary will come and congratulate you. Lance will save you from the interview, and will take you to the back room where he'll enter them in the Hall of Fame. Then you will watch the credits and see "The End".
